Output 93a04ca462e50c8dd202deb823ed9e3f7f04c3ce38beed4c48abe92f25d27497:3

value
11100132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 383b95f9e575d838d3e4e3078a62463887178a78 OP_EQUAL
address
MD2VTGbew6ZgLPw2jweyRzH38AXLRU38iP
transaction
93a04ca462e50c8dd202deb823ed9e3f7f04c3ce38beed4c48abe92f25d27497
spent
true